Diffusion looks great.

If you have a colour cast you could setup a white balance by shooting a spectrographic reference card with it, either in camera if you use JPG or as a click balance in your raw processer (best way for me).

gnome chompski wrote in post #16443507 (external link)
what are you using there? Pringles canister and what on the end?

Styrofoam bowl, and a sheet of thin packing foam... the stuff that often covers a new TV screen or computer monitor. I've also used a sheet of paper towel (actually a split sheet of two-ply), but it rips pretty easily.
